Introduction to Steel Grating

Steel grating, also known as steel grid or grating panel, is made by welding flat steel and twisted steel. Durable and cost-effective compared to other products, steel grating is primarily used for power plant platforms, parking lot platforms, maintenance platforms, drainage covers, and step plates. It is also employed in environmental protection equipment and wastewater treatment. Steel grating is widely used in platforms, walkways, gangways, drainage covers, manholes, ladders, fences, and more across various fields such as petrochemicals, electricity, water supply, wastewater treatment, ports, construction decoration, shipbuilding, self-propelled parking lots, municipal engineering, and environmental sanitation projects.

Steel Grating Plates

Also known as steel grating or grating panel, it is a type of steel product made by crossing flat steel bars at specific intervals with crossbars, then焊接 into a square grid pattern. It is primarily used for drain covers, steel structure platform panels, and step boards for steel ladders. The crossbars are typically made of twisted square steel.

Manufacturing Method of Steel Grating Plates: Steel grating plates are made by arranging load-bearing flat steel and crossbars at a certain spacing, then焊接 using a 200-ton hydraulic resistance welding automation machine to form the original plate. The plates are then processed through cutting, punching, and edging, etc., to meet the customer's requirements. Spacing of Load-bearing Flat Steel: The spacing between adjacent load-bearing flat steels is commonly 30, 40, 50, and other sizes. Spacing of Crossbars: The distance between adjacent crossbars is typically 50, 76, 80, 100, and other sizes, which can be produced according to customer requirements and customized in various models of steel grating plates.

Hot-Dipped Galvanized Steel Grating

The product is a finished item, meticulously crafted from load flat steel and crossbars arranged in a certain spacing,焊接 on a high-voltage resistance welding machine, followed by deep processing steps such as cutting, notching, punching, and edging to meet customer specifications.

Hot-dip galvanized steel grating is divided into the following types:

1. Hot-dip galvanized steel grating, categorized by manufacturing process, includes press-welded hot-dip galvanized steel grating and press-locked hot-dip galvanized steel grating.

2. Hot-dip galvanized steel grating surfaces are categorized by shape into serrated hot-dip galvanized steel grating and flat hot-dip galvanized steel grating.

3. Type I hot-dip galvanized steel grating and composite hot-dip galvanized steel grating.

Identification Method:

(1) Hot-Dip Galvanized Steel Grating Slotted Steel Spacing: Distinguished by series: Series 1 is 30mm; Series 2 is 40mm; Series 3 is 60mm.

(2) Hot-dip galvanized steel grating cross-bar spacing: Series 1 is 100mm, Series 2 is 50mm. Other specifications are available upon request.

(3) Hot-Dip Galvanized Steel Grating: Made of Q23 steel or stainless steel, available in flat, anti-slip toothed, and I-section designs. Common sizes include 20*5, 25*5, 25*3, 32*5, 32*5, 40*5, 40*3, 50*5, 65*5, 75*6, 100*8, and 100*10.

(4) Hot-Dip Galvanized Steel Grating Crossbars: Made of round steel, twisted square steel, square steel, or hexagonal steel in material Q23 or 304 stainless steel. Twisted square steel is produced by drawing through a square die from round steel coil and then twisting it, with common sizes including 5*5, 6*6, 8*8mm, etc.

Heavy-duty steel grating

1. Heavy-duty steel grating introduction:

Heavy-duty steel grating refers to steel grating with a bearing width of over 65mm and a bearing thickness of over 6mm, with cross bars typically made of flat steel or rebar with a diameter of 10mm or 12mm.

2. Heavy-duty steel grating applications:

Heavy-duty steel grating is designed and manufactured for heavy load applications, suitable for airports, highways, industrial platforms, port wharfs, and other special demand scenarios.

3. Heavy-duty steel grating classifications:

4. Heavy-duty steel grating can be divided into two types according to the production process: heavy-duty welded steel grating and heavy-duty locked steel grating.

A. Heavy-duty welded steel grating refers to a type of grating with steel bars used as transverse bars, suitable for single-direction loading applications.

B. Heavy-duty press-locked steel grating refers to grating with flat steel crossbars, suitable for bidirectional loading applications. However, it is significantly more expensive than welded steel grating, and is generally not recommended for use.

C. Surface shape can be divided into flat heavy-duty steel grating and ribbed heavy-duty steel grating.

Due to cost considerations, we recommend using flat steel grating in general situations and heavy-duty toothed steel grating for anti-slip applications such as offshore oil drilling platforms.

Composite steel grating

This product is composed of steel grating with certain transverse bearing capacity and patterned plate with a sealed surface. After hot-dip galvanizing, composite steel grating may experience warping and deformation due to heat, especially with larger sizes, which can be challenging to flatten. Please note the selection of size. The common series for the bottom plate of composite steel grating is Series 3, but Series 1 or Series 2 can also be used; patterned steel grating typically uses 3mm thick plates, but 4mm, 5mm, or 6mm plates can also be chosen. A composite grating with a steel mesh bonded to the front or back can prevent small items from falling out. Using such a composite grating in grain silos, dining halls, and warehouses can prevent rodents and other small animals from entering.

Composite Steel Grating Installation Method: Directly weld the steel grating or tread plate to the supporting steel structure, and apply two coats of zinc-rich paint at the welding joints. Use steel grating installation clamps for assembly, which do not damage the galvanized layer and are easy to disassemble. Each set of installation clamps includes one top clamp, one bottom clamp, one M8 round head bolt, and one nut. Stainless steel installation clamps or bolt connection methods can be provided upon request. The installation gap for steel grating is generally 100mm. Ensure the installation is secure and reliable during assembly, and regularly check to prevent clamps from loosening and falling off. It is recommended to weld or add rubber pads to steel grating near vibration sources.

Platform steel grating

Platform steel grating is a widely applicable product within the steel grating plate category. It is primarily used in various platforms across factories, workshops, mining, and ports. It boasts an aesthetically pleasing appearance, easy installation, and is a new type of building product that represents an upgrade and replacement.

Platform specialty steel grating products include:

1. Kick plates (edge plates), patterned steel plate guards, and mounting accessories can be additionally welded around the steel grating perimeter.

2. Utilize flanges with different specifications from those on the steel grating, or use angle iron, channel iron, square tubes, etc., for edging.

3. Handles and hinges can be installed on platform steel grating panels that are frequently moved or opened.

4. Generally speaking: The welding standard for the edge of platform steel grating panels is as follows: Series 1 - weld one out of every five; Series 2 - weld one out of every four; Series 3 - weld one out of every three. The welds are single-sided angular welds not less than 3mm, with a length of 20mm.

Stainless Steel Grating

Also known as stainless steel grating panels. There are usually two methods of production: one involves welding together stainless steel flat bars and round bars; the other involves interlocking stainless steel flat bars. They offer excellent corrosion resistance, a neat appearance, and a very ideal decorative effect, although they are generally more expensive.

Stainless Steel Grating Classification:

It can be categorized into flat, toothed, and I-shaped designs, with over 200 specifications and varieties (the surface can be treated with different protective coatings depending on the application environment).

Material: Generally, stainless steel grades 304, 316, 316L are commonly used.

Manufacturing Method:

There are two types: machine press welding and handcrafted. Machine press welding uses a high-voltage resistance welding machine, where a robotic arm automatically places the crossbar horizontally on evenly arranged flat steel bars, then welds it into the flat steel using strong welding power and hydraulic pressure, resulting in a high-quality steel grating with strong weld points, high stability, and strength. Handcrafted steel gratings are first punched on the flat steel, then the crossbar is inserted into the holes and spot-welded. There will be gaps between the crossbar and the flat steel, but each contact point is焊接, achieving an equivalent melting connection between the flat steel and the twisted steel, making the welding more solid and the strength slightly improved, although the appearance is not as aesthetically pleasing as press welding.

Surface Treatment:

After pickling and passivation, the surface appears as a matte grayish white.

b. Electrochemical polishing, with a brighter surface and higher luster.

c. The finished products are heat and polished, followed by electrochemical polishing, and then chrome plated to achieve a mirror-like finish.

Stainless Steel Grating Cover


Stainless steel channel covers, also known as stair tread plates, steel stair tread plates, and tread plates, are a type of stairboard used on platforms. They are available in two installation methods: welded connection and bolted connection. Welded tread plates can be directly welded onto the stair beam.

Overview

Welded fixed tread plates, directly welded to the ladder beam, without the need for side plates for the tread plates; relatively economical but not easily removable. Tread plates secured with bolts require thicker side plates, with holes pre-drilled on the sides, which are fixed directly by bolts, allowing for recyclability and reuse. Customers can customize according to their specific needs, using suitable types of steel grating to create various sizes to match the respective staircase.

Studded steel grating

Interlocking Steel Grating: Also known as parallel interlocking steel grating, it is manufactured through processes such as slotting (punching), interlocking, welding, and finishing, using steel flats, stainless steel, brass, and aluminum plates of certain dimensions. The interlocking steel grating combines the high strength, corrosion resistance, and maintenance-free features of common steel grating with uniformity, lightweight and exquisite structure, natural harmony, and elegant style. This product is widely used for drain covers, stair treads, and pond covers.


Category:


Interlocking steel grating types can be divided into four categories: Interlocking steel grating classification: Depending on different insertion methods and angles, it can be categorized into pressed steel grating, heavy-duty steel grating, integral steel grating, sunshade curtain steel grating, etc.


1. Pressed Steel Grating: After the flat steel carrying load is notched, the crossbar flat steel is pressed and locked into shape. Generally, the large processing height for standard steel grating production is 100mm. The length of the steel grating is usually less than 2000mm.


2. Heavy-duty steel grating is a product made by interlocking high flange steel and cross bar steel, tightly formed under 1200 tons of pressure. It is suitable for high span and heavy load applications.


3. Integral Grating Panels - The integral grating panels feature load-bearing flat bars and cross bars of the same height with槽 depths that are half the height of the load-bearing flat bars. The height of the grating does not exceed 100mm. The length of the grating is typically less than 2000mm.


4. Sunshade Type Interlocking Steel Grating: The load-bearing flat steel of the sunshade type interlocking steel grating features 30° or 45° slits, with the slot bars formed by pressing and locking. We can deliver grating panels with different spacings and specifications as per your requirements, using materials such as plain carbon steel, stainless steel, aluminum, etc. The height of the grating panels is less than 100mm.
